Men's golf places third at NAC Championships

BRANDON, Vt. -- The University of Maine at Farmington golf team placed third at the North Atlantic Conference Championships at Neshobe Country Club this weekend.

Husson University captured the championship for the fifth straight year. The Eagles posted a two-day total of 585 to stay ahead of Castleton State College (618) and Farmington (620). Maine Maritime Academy (721), Johnson State College (724) and Green Mountain College (813) rounded out the tournament field.

Castleton's William Banfield captured medalist honors with a two-round total of 141 (72-69).

Nick Waltz (Damariscotta, Maine) finished fourth to lead the Beavers at 146 (76-70) and earned all-conference recognition, while Orion Cochrane (Greenville, Maine) placed seventh at 154 (78-76).

Farmington's Joe Messerman (Brunswick, Maine) received NAC Rookie of the Year honors after shooting a 160 (84-76) to tie teammate Rich Matthews (Portland, Maine) at 11th. Matthews shot 85-75. Reid Bond (Farmington, Maine) turned in a 183 (93-90) to come in 21st.
